Onipokia Tussle: Chief Obanla Denies Rumour For Congratulating Oba Yisa on Radio Station




Chief Obanla Oteni, The Olori ebi Oteni Dodo, Ruling House, in Ipokia Local Government Ogun State has denied congratulating the newly installed Oba Yisa Olaniyan on a Radio Station.

The royal  family house  in a Statement denied congratulating Oba Yisa Olaniyan, knowing fully well that the case over the stool of Onipokia was still in the court of law.

According to the Secretary of the Dodo ruling house, ' Mrs. Ruth Okeleye, in Ipokia presently we didn't have any monarch.

She said: " Our father didn't congratulates the newly installed Oba on any  Radio Station, when he knew that their is a case pending in court concerning the stool, we want to inform the general public and the loving people of Ipokia that we didn't sponsored nor congratulate him.

"How on earth is possible for him to congratulate the person you are competing with, when you have not lost out of the race, we also want to warned the Radio Station to stopped mentioned the name of our father in the congratulatery advertorial being aired on such  Radio Station.

Okeleye, described the installation of the current Onipokia of Ipokia Kingdom, Oba Yisa Olaniyan as ‘nullity and contempt of court, noting that Gov. Dapo Abiodun was ill-informed on the issue.

She insisted that, the stool of Onipokia remains vacant until the Court gives judgement.

She also maintained that, the newly installed Onipokia of Ipokia kingdom, was not a descendant of the dodo Ruling house and thus, not eligible to ascend the throne.

She however called on members of the family to remain calm, shun violence and expect justice from the court.
